Output 237caa03b8b318914d02f3e54a5fa7158318ba132db9545016d023dfa6ba4084:0

value
34856258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c928d2c6e715b00a40d87a1f7f8e21c0dfde839d OP_EQUAL
address
3L2eeZHxB6zYzdAo2cLD3hMkFP2sRG8W8s
transaction
237caa03b8b318914d02f3e54a5fa7158318ba132db9545016d023dfa6ba4084
spent
true